[0026] Embodiment 1: Determination of detection standard and establishment of method
[0027] Vibrio harveyi strains from different sources were expanded and cultured by spectrophotometer and plate counting method, and then diluted with PBS solution to a concentration of 8×10 8 CFU / mL of bacterial liquid. 150-200 g of healthy large yellow croakers were selected for each strain and randomly divided into three test groups and a control group, with ten fish in each group. 100 microliters, 200 microliters, and 300 microliters were injected intramuscularly, and the control group was injected with the same dose of PBS solution. The pathogenic Vibrio harveii with a mortality rate of 100% within seven days is a non-pathogenic Vibrio harveyi with a lethal rate of less than 20%.

[0051] Embodiment 2: detection of unknown Vibrio harveyi pathogenicity
[0052] 1. Cultivation of unknown Vibrio harveyi species
[0053] The Vibrio harveyi to be tested was inoculated with seawater beef extract peptone solid culture, and cultured by streaking. Incubate at 28°C for 24 hours. The medium formula is as follows: 1% peptone, 0.3% beef extract, 2% agar, and seawater is added to a certain value.
